gpt4 book ai didi

vb.net - 短路 : OrElse combined with Or

转载 作者:行者123 更新时间:2023-12-04 17:28:15 36 4
gpt4 key购买 nike

如果我有以下...

a OrElse b 

... 并且 a 是 那么显然 b 永远不会被评估。但是如果我添加一个 Or ,然后呢?
a OrElse b Or c

c 是否/应该得到评估?如果我放入一些括号怎么办?

抱歉,如果这是基本的。当然,我可以自己测试答案,但我无法在这里或其他地方找到这个问题的答案。很多问题处理 Or 与 OrElse 但没有处理 或与 OrElse

最佳答案

OrElse 左右侧参数之间短路(只有2个参数)。所以我会说 C将始终被评估,因为您可以将其视为 (A OrElse B) Or C .

MSDN OrElse

关于vb.net - 短路 : OrElse combined with Or,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/3677703/

36 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com